Hey could use some help. I gotta really high idle whenever I start up my car and then after about 5 minutes of driving it will go crazy. Like it should start out at the 1 on the tach, but instead it starts on the 2. Then whenever I stop at a stop sign or red light it will start revings slowly from 1.5 to almost 3. It cant be good for my car. Just could use some insight on my issue. Thanks.
